Adrien stared at the door during class. He was waiting for Marinette to come back from the nurse's office. His heart soared a little when he saw Alya open the door and walk in. It sank again, however, when he realized that Marinette wasn't with her.
"Where's Marinette?" Adrien whispered over to her when she sat down.
"The nurse wanted her to rest for a while," she whispered back.
Adrien sighed and continued staring at the door.
Marinette didn't show up for their class. And she didn't show up for the next one either.
During lunch hour Adrien went back to the nurse's office.
"Is there any chance that I can see Marinette?" he asked the nurse.
"I'm afraid she's still resting. She hit her head pretty hard when she fell so she needs to lie down for a while."
"Oh okay," he said, disappointed. "Could you at least tell her that I came by?"
"Of course, sweetie," the nurse replied.
Adrien then met up with Alya and Nino for lunch, but he wasn't hungry enough to eat anything.
All day long he waited for her to rejoin their class, but she never did.
The final bell rang and the three friends went to the locker room to put their books away.
"So I'm having a little get-together at my house tomorrow night if you want to come over. I'm pretty much inviting everyone from class," Alya told Adrien when they were at their lockers.
"Okay, I'll have to ask my father," Adrien replied unenthusiastically.
"Is everything okay, dude?" Nino asked. "You've been acting strange all day."
"I just feel horrible about Marinette."
"It's okay Adrien," Alya said to him, noticing how upset he was. "I'm sure she's going to be fine."

"Yeah, Marinette's a tough girl," Nino added. "I can't tell you guys how many times she's fallen since I've known her. She has to be used to it by now."
Alya chuckled. "Poor girl. I just don't understand what she tripped over." She looked around them. "I mean, there's nothing even here."
"She probably tripped over her own foot," Nino joked.
"Wait a second," Alya said, bending over and picking something up off the floor by the window. "Maybe she slipped on this."
It was a slim rectangular box with green wrapping.
Adrien's eyes went wide at seeing it. "That... that's what Marinette was holding before she fell," he said.
Alya stared at it. "Well it looks like it's for you," she said, holding the box out to Adrien.
He slowly reached over and took the gift from her hand. There was a note attached to it. A note that hadn't been there the night before when he first saw the gift.
Dear Adrien,
I thought you might still be looking for this. I hope you enjoy.
Love, your friend Marinette
P.S. I finally remembered to sign something. You should be very proud ;)
After reading the note, Adrien quickly unwrapped the gift. He gasped when he saw what it was.
His mother's face stared up at him from the cover of the DVD. The title 'Solitude' was written across the bottom.
Adrien couldn't breathe. Marinette had found his mother's movie. The movie he had been searching for, but was never able to find. The only time he had seen it was when he watched it in his room with his father. But after that his father took it back and he hadn't seen it since.
Tears welled up in his eyes as he looked at it. "It's my mom's movie," he explained quietly.

Alya nodded slightly and glanced over at Nino.
Suddenly Adrien looked up at them. "I have to go see her," he said, putting the gift in his school bag. He hurried out of the locker room, leaving a confused Alya and Nino behind.
He ran straight to the nurse's office. "Is Marinette still here? I need to see her," he said, panting.
"Oh I'm sorry, but Marinette left a few minutes ago. I told her to go home and rest."
"Thank you!" he yelled over his shoulder, running out of the office.
He went to the courtyard and looked around, but she wasn't there. Then he rushed outside and looked up the sidewalk towards her house.
She was already about half way home.
Adrien sprinted down the sidewalk. "Marinette!" he called out.
At hearing her name and recognizing the voice that said it, Marinette stopped. She turned around once Adrien caught up with her. They were about two meters apart from one another.
Adrien took a moment to catch his breath, and then he spoke. "Th... thank you for my mom's movie," he sputtered out.
Marinette stared at him. "You're welcome," she said quietly.
"I've been searching for it forever. Where did you find it?" he asked.
"I, uh... I... I know someone... who knows someone... and that's how I found it," she said, averting his gaze.
They were silent for a minute.
Marinette looked back up at him but he didn't say anything. She started to turn around to head home.
"I'm sorry Marinette," he said suddenly, making the blunette stop and turn back towards him. "I'm so sorry" he pleaded.
She opened her mouth to say something but was interrupted by a car horn honking. Adrien's bodyguard was getting impatient. She closed her mouth and looked at the ground.
"I, uh... I guess I have to go," he said.
Marinette nodded and turned away, continuing her walk home.
Adrien watched her go the entire way until she disappeared into the bakery. Then he turned around and went to the waiting car, climbing inside.
